2. Red Rust
If the rust is left for a long time, it will result in thick brown rust and damage the
stainless steel surface. In this condition, it is not easy to remove the rust and the
surface cannot be restored, therefore it is important to remove the rust in the early
stage
of the rusting.
If the rust is not removed by a commercial cleaning agent, it can be easily removed by
using a cleaning agent after removing some rust in advance with sand paper or a
stainless steel brush. In this case, it is necessary to repair the surface by cleaning and
regrinding.
3. Rust by iron powder
- Welding spatter at the time of construction, rust water flowing down from steel in the
upper part of stainless steel, rust generated in contact with stainless steel and ordinary
iron products during storage, corrosion of dissimilar metals due to potential difference
occurs, at the initial stage
steel rusts first and if kept as is it is the stainless steel itself
rusts. Therefore, it should be removed with neutral detergent at the beginning of
rusting stage. If the rust state has developed further, it should be removed with 15%
nitric acid solution or commercially available stainless steel cleaner.
4. Rust due to exhaust gas or acid rain
- It is easy to get dirty and spot rust due to exhaust gas or acid rain in the location
environment where there is a lot of traffic in a factory or city area. Relatively light rust
can be cleaned with a neutral
detergent or soapy water, but if it gets worse, it should
be removed with 15% nitric acid solution or a commercially available stainless steel
cleaner.
5. Rust due to salt deposition
When exposed to a sea breeze even STS304 makes red rust in a short time. In some
cases STS316 also rusts and rust progresses faster than in other areas. In this case,
painted stainless steel is used or special care is required such as regular cleaning.
6. Rust by disinfection and cleaning agent
- Chlorine-based disinfectants are used to disinfect water in places such as swimming
pools and bathrooms. In the case of chlorine-based cleaning agents such as ROX used
for cleaning toilets, etc., many chlorine compounds are attached to the surface of
stainless steel and results in rusting in many cases. When chlorine-based disinfectants
are used, it is important to thoroughly wash them with water to ensure that no residue
remains. They must be removed with 15% nitric acid solution or Stainless Steel Cleaner.

1. Stain type initial rust
- Since the initial rusted stainless steel surface itself is only slightly affected by the stain, it
can be returned to almost the original surface by selecting a neutral detergent or a
commercially available cleaning solution. If it is regularly cleaned at a proper frequency, the
state of the rust can stop at this stage and you can remove the rust easily and cheaply.
